Iran - Real interest rate

Real interest rate (%)

The value for Real interest rate (%) in Iran was 11.34 as of 2009. As the graph below shows, over the past 5 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 11.34 in 2009 and a minimum value of -7.02 in 2007.

Definition: Real interest rate is the lending interest rate adjusted for inflation as measured by the GDP deflator.

Source: International Monetary Fund, International Financial Statistics and data files using World Bank data on the GDP deflator.
